What Is a Dual Battery System and How Does It Work in Jeep Vehicles?
A dual battery system in Jeep vehicles consists of two batteries working together to provide power. This setup enables improved energy management for accessories and electronics, especially during off-road adventures.
The definition of a dual battery system aligns with explanations from automotive experts and manufacturers, including the Jeep website, which details how this system helps manage power distribution efficiently.
A dual battery system typically features a primary battery for vehicle operation and a secondary battery for auxiliary power. The secondary battery supports electronic devices, such as lights, winches, and refrigerators, without risking depletion of the primary battery. This system often includes a battery isolator to prevent the primary battery from being drained.

What Features Should You Consider When Choosing a Dual Battery Kit for Your Jeep?
When choosing a dual battery kit for your Jeep, consider factors such as compatibility, capacity, and safety features.
- Compatibility with your Jeep model
- Battery capacity (amp hours)
- Charging system type (isolator or manager)
- Physical size and mounting options
- Safety features (fuses, circuit protection)
- Brand reputation and warranty
- User-friendly installation requirements
These factors provide a clear framework for evaluating a dual battery kit. Each point offers unique insights and varying levels of importance depending on individual needs and preferences.
-
Compatibility with Your Jeep Model: Compatibility with your Jeep model is crucial. Some dual battery kits are designed specifically for certain models, ensuring correct fit and function. Improper compatibility can lead to system failures or inefficient performance.
-
Battery Capacity (Amp Hours): Battery capacity is measured in amp hours, which indicates how long the battery can provide a certain amount of electrical current. Higher capacity batteries can power more devices for a longer period. For off-road enthusiasts, a setup with at least 100 amp hours is often recommended.
-
Charging System Type (Isolator or Manager): The charging system is another essential feature to consider. An isolator allows one battery to recharge while the other is dedicated to power consumption. A battery manager optimizes charging and discharging, providing greater efficiency. Choosing between these systems can affect battery longevity and vehicle performance.
-
Physical Size and Mounting Options: Physical size and mounting options impact the installation process. A battery kit should fit in your Jeep’s designated battery tray without modifications. Some kits offer adjustable mounting brackets for easier installation in tighter spaces.
-
Safety Features (Fuses, Circuit Protection): Safety features protect both the battery and the vehicle’s electrical system. Look for kits that include fuses and circuit protection mechanisms. These components prevent overloads that could damage the battery or create fire hazards.
-
Brand Reputation and Warranty: Brand reputation is often an indicator of quality and reliability. Research user reviews and feedback to ensure the product meets safety standards. A solid warranty can also provide peace of mind, indicating the manufacturer’s confidence in their product.
-
User-Friendly Installation Requirements: Finally, consider the installation requirements. Some kits come with detailed instructions and all necessary hardware, making it easier for DIY enthusiasts. If you are not comfortable with electrical work, a user-friendly kit may save time and prevent errors during installation.

How Can You Successfully Set Up a Dual Battery System in a Jeep Wrangler or Gladiator?
To successfully set up a dual battery system in a Jeep Wrangler or Gladiator, you need to select the right components, wire them correctly, and ensure a proper mounting solution.
-
Component Selection:
– Choose two batteries with compatible specifications. Typically, a deep cycle battery and a starter battery work well together.
– Consider using a battery isolator to prevent both batteries from discharging simultaneously. This ensures the starter battery remains charged for vehicle ignition. -
Wiring:
– Use thick gauge wire to connect the batteries to minimize voltage drop. A wire size of at least 4 AWG is common for this application.
– Connect the positive terminals of both batteries together using a battery distribution terminal. Then, connect the battery isolator from the starter battery to the ignition.
– Connect the negative terminal of the deep cycle battery to a solid vehicle ground. -
Mounting Solutions:
– Use a battery tray or enclosure to secure the second battery within the engine bay or cargo area. Ensure it is ventilated to prevent gas buildup.
– Make sure the installation complies with vehicle specifications and does not interfere with any critical components. -
Testing and Maintenance:
– After installation, verify the voltage levels of both batteries. They should be close in value when fully charged.
– Periodically check connections for corrosion or wear. Clean terminals with a wire brush if necessary.
– Monitor battery health regularly. Consider using a battery management system to keep track of charge and discharge cycles.
This setup enhances electrical capacity, allowing for the use of additional accessories without risking vehicle start-up.
What Maintenance Practices Are Essential for Your Jeep’s Dual Battery System?
To maintain your Jeep’s dual battery system effectively, several critical practices should be followed.
- Regular Inspection of Battery Connections
- Checking Battery Voltage
- Monitoring Fluid Levels
- Cleaning Battery Terminals
- Testing Battery Performance
- Ensuring Proper Battery Placement
- Staying Updated on Software and Firmware
Regular maintenance practices play a vital role in ensuring the longevity and efficiency of your Jeep’s dual battery system. Below are detailed explanations for each practice.
-
Regular Inspection of Battery Connections: Regularly inspecting battery connections is crucial. Loose or corroded connections can prevent proper charging and discharging. Ensure that cables are tight and free from corrosion. According to a study by the Automotive Battery Council, poor connections lead to reduced battery performance and lifespan.
-
Checking Battery Voltage: Checking the battery voltage is important to gauge health. A fully charged battery should read around 12.6 to 12.8 volts at rest. You can use a multimeter for accurate readings. A study by Battery University highlights that maintaining optimal voltage is key to preventing battery failure.
-
Monitoring Fluid Levels: Monitoring fluid levels in lead-acid batteries is essential. The electrolyte should cover the plates but not overflow. Low fluid levels can cause damage to the battery. As per the National Renewable Energy Laboratory, ensuring proper electrolyte levels can enhance battery lifespan by up to 50%.
-
Cleaning Battery Terminals: Cleaning battery terminals helps prevent corrosion. Dirt and corrosion can increase resistance. Use a mixture of baking soda and water to clean terminals. The Vehicle Electrical Systems Special Interest Group suggests cleaning every few months to maintain efficient performance.
